  • Customs & Habits

     

    The multicultural and confluent folk customs of Fujian mainly originate from the aboriginal folk-custom before Qing Dynasty and Han Dynasty, the folk-custom of Han nationality, the custom of minority nationalities and the foreign customs. The confluence feature of Fujian folk customs is represented by the confluence of folk customs of different nationalities and different regions of the Han nationality, as well as the confluence of Chinese customs and foreign customs.   

    Fujian is also the principal habitat of She nationality, of which the custom, featuring strong nationalistic styles, has become an important part of Fujian's folk customs. Furthermore, some customs of Mongolian (Yuan Dynasty) and Manchurian (Qing Dynasty) have also been integrated in folk customs of Fujian, while the costume of Hui'an Women, Hakka Tulou (building constructed with clay) and the habit of snake worship and carp protection are all special folk customs of Fujian.
